Before I could react, she shoved me from the edge. I crashed onto the emergency airbag below, and pain tore through my entire body. When the staff hauled me back up, her childhood friend Mason Lowell was holding up his phone, laughing until he could barely breathe. The screen replayed my humiliating fall again and again. "Vanessa, did you see his face?" The moment he laughed, Vanessa finally relaxed. Mason was autistic, but for some reason, watching me suffer always delighted him. So during the ten years Vanessa and I were together, scenes like this happened countless times. When I lost my job, Vanessa hung a banner and celebrated with him. When I was hospitalized after a crash, she stood outside my room with him and laughed. Every year on his birthday, she made me dress as a clown to entertain him. She knew that undoing a safety line at that height could kill me. But if it made Mason happy, Vanessa never hesitated to put me in danger. Blood from my split forehead blurred my vision. As I wiped it away, I suddenly wanted to walk away from the ten years I'd spent refusing to give up.
